Description

Discover! English Language Arts 8 guides students through literary analysis, multicultural literature, persuasive writing, argumentation, poetry, theater, historical and science fiction, research skills, documentary film, and digital literacy tools. Students will analyze different literature portions in their workbooks and then follow up with writing and essay assignments. 

There is a total of 160 days of instruction, and each chapter will take 2 days to complete. On day one students will complete the explore and read section. This provides students with new information presented in real-world narrative and they will read information about the chapter topic. On Day 2, they will complete the Practice and Show What You Know pages. Students will reflect on the information that was presented on Day 1 and apply it with graphic organizers, drawing, matching, writing prompts, and other various practice activities. Review of what you know will culminate the chapter with review questions over the chapters content and essay questions.

Set includes consumable Student Worktext 8A, 8B, Instructor’s Guide, and Assessment Booklet.

Publisher's Description of Discover! ELA 8th Grade Set
Uncover how literature and writing shape personal identity in this engaging, full-year English Language Arts course. Discover! English Language Arts Grade 8 guides students through literary analysis, multicultural literature, informational and persuasive writing, argument and debate, poetry, theater, historical and science fiction, contemporary literature, research skills, documentary film, and digital literacy tools. This comprehensive package includes:
  • Student Worktext A: begins with advanced literary analysis and critical writing and continues with multicultural literature, expository and informational writing, debate and argumentative writing, and poetry and figurative language. Each unit features a related career, such as a book critic, comparative literature professor, technical writer, advertising executive, and spoken word artist.
  • Student Worktext B: begins with theater and cinema and continues with the exploration of historical fiction and nonfiction, science fiction and fantasy, modern and contemporary literature, research skills and documentary film, and digital literacy and media production. Each unit features a related career such as working as a screenwriter, publishing fact checker, book designer, documentary producer, and media strategist.
  • Instructor Guide: takes the guesswork out of lesson planning, offering helpful teaching tips, pacing suggestions, and complete answer keys for all activities and assessments.
  • Assessment Booklet: supports students in becoming confident, independent learners. Each unit includes a traditional assessment modeled after standardized tests and a performance assessment that challenges students to apply their understanding in creative, meaningful ways. Rubrics are included to support consistent and clear evaluation.
This course is designed for 8th grade students.
